Dubai’s Business Landscape
Dubai’s appeal lies in its free zones offering 0% corporate tax, 100% foreign ownership, and streamlined visa processes, attracting over 20,000 new entities annually. The 2025 regulatory reforms, including enhanced digital licensing via the DED portal, have slashed setup times to days while bolstering sectors like fintech, logistics, and renewables. Advisors leverage this environment to align client strategies with UAE’s Vision 2031, focusing on diversification beyond oil.
Key drivers include the DIFC’s $4 trillion asset management hub and DMCC’s commodity trade dominance, creating a fertile ground for cross-border ventures. Challenges like VAT compliance (5%) and evolving corporate tax (9% from 2024) demand specialized guidance to avoid pitfalls and maximize incentives.
Core Corporate Advisory Services
Corporate advisors in Dubai offer comprehensive, tailored solutions across multiple domains:
-
Business Setup and Structuring: Assistance with mainland, free zone, or offshore entities, including trade license selection, MOA drafting, and Ejari tenancy. This ensures compliance from day one, with options like the Golden Visa for investors.
-
Strategic Market Entry: Feasibility studies, competitor analysis, and localization plans. Advisors identify optimal jurisdictions—e.g., JLT for finance or Dubai Silicon Oasis for tech—reducing entry barriers by 40%.
-
Mergers, Acquisitions, and Restructuring: End-to-end M&A support, from valuation and due diligence to negotiation and integration. Amid 2025’s surge in UAE-India pacts, these services facilitate seamless deals.
-
Financial and Tax Advisory: Virtual CFO services, budgeting, cash flow forecasting, and tax optimization under UAE’s new 9% regime. Includes transfer pricing and double taxation avoidance.
-
Risk Management and Compliance: Audits, AML/KYC frameworks, cybersecurity protocols, and ESG reporting to meet PDPL data laws and green initiatives in zones like Masdar City.
-
HR and Immigration: PRO services for employee visas, labor cards, and Emiratization quotas (2-5% local hires by 2026).
These services integrate via phased engagements, often starting with a diagnostic audit.
